Transaction 32bf950c199553b600e2800513cb69a82ceb475d1bd8fc95383a82582dfa77d3
1 Input
1 Output
-
32bf950c199553b600e2800513cb69a82ceb475d1bd8fc95383a82582dfa77d3:0
- value
- 106092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5b5b77f72352771019bc240bf9c015002e41f06 OP_EQUAL
- address
- 3MB1YJnUrb7wFTHteJc8cLWWNHVEurfRud